The Step-by-Step Guide to the Diapering Process
Changing a baby's absorbent pad can seem daunting at the beginning , but with some experience, it becomes easy . Here’s a breakdown to this process: First, collect your necessities, which consist of a nappy , cleansing pads, a ointment (if needed), and a clean surface . Next, carefully place the infant on the mat. Then, undo the tabs on the diaper , being careful not to make some contents. Wash the little one's skin thoroughly with wipes , front to back for baby girls to prevent bacteria . Apply lotion when needed . Finally, secure a clean nappy , ensuring it's snug , but not too tight .
- Don’t forget to consistently check the diaper often.
- Throw away the nappy properly .
- Sanitize the area thoroughly after every change .
A Nappy Supplies Checklist for Content Little Ones
Getting set for your little one's arrival requires more than just adorable clothing ; it's vitally about having the appropriate nappy changing items on hand! This is a helpful list to guarantee you're stocked to deal with those frequent changes .
- A good supply diapers – plan on at least 12-15 per period for newborns .
- Baby cloths – select gentle options .
- Nappy rash cream – a requirement to safeguard baby's skin .
- Nappy changing pads – to protect your areas .
- A convenient changing place.
- Additional zippered containers for used nappies.
